Tasting Notes

The 2017 Rauzan Gassies offers good depth, but firm tannins and angular contours convey a feeling of rusticity. Even so, the 2017 finishes with real weight and gravitas. It will be interesting to see if it acquires a bit more finesse during the course of its aging.

Score: 89 - 92 Antonio Galloni, Vinous.com Date: 01 May 2018

The 2017 Rauzan Gassies has a predictably light, rather herbaceous bouquet that does not quite click out of second gear. The palate is medium-bodied with dry, slightly green tannin and it feels a little hollow towards the finish. I always wish this Margaux would improve but frustratingly it rarely delivers where it matters...in the glass.

Score: 84 - 86 Neal Martin, Vinous.com Maturity: 2020-2030 Date: 01 May 2018

Deep greyish crimson. Light spice over sweet black fruit. Firm, smoothly textured tannins, just enough fruit at the core to keep it in balance. No lack of freshness but could do with a little more fruit depth for harmony and long-term ageing.

Score: 16 Julia Harding MW, JancisRobinson.com Maturity: 2024-2032 Date: 25 April 2018

The Margaux appellation, while not as consistent as Pauillac, did well in 2017. The 2017 Château Rauzan-Gassies offers an exotic, complex, medium-bodied style as well as good concentration, ripe tannin, and the fresher, more mid-weight style of the vintage. I like its overall balance, and it has quality tannin, all suggesting a solid wine.

Score: 89 - 91 Jeb Dunnuck, JebDunnuck.com Date: 23 April 2018

Tight and lightly chewy with pretty dark fruit, stone and real terroir character. Firm and silky. Very pretty. Better than 2016?

Score: 91 - 92 James Suckling, JamesSuckling.com Date: 06 April 2018

A highly attractive wine, showing soft floral aromatics and finely-expressed black cherry fruits, nicely defined. The constraints of the vintage see a little dilution through the mid-palate but it has been extremely well handled, with a careful delivery, although it lacks reach. For medium-term drinking.

Score: 89 Jane Anson, Decanter.com Maturity: 2024-2036 Date: 01 April 2018
